Ok I have noticed that there are no Pirate Galaxy guides in this forum, I couldn't find any, so I decided to make one. The following guide is aimed at new players, to teach them how to advance through the game without making bad decisions.

So you start in Vega system and I believe you wont have much trouble finishing Vega's story missions (the yellow missions). After Vega, you unlock antares system. Now I understand that you are so curious to see what antares looks like, but dont worry, it wont go, it will be there for you. It is important for you to remain in Vega for some time, and focus on normal missions (white missions) for some time. Yes I know they are too boring, but believe me, they will help you a lot. Focus on finding the best vega blueprints for the ship u have, so the missions are easier. If u unlocked antares, you can go there and upgrade your armor. After you are done with your current ship, make sure to finish all the white missions in vega, or at least the aurora ones as they give good cryonite.

Now that you have made some good cryonite, you can go to antares. Your priority is to find BPs. You might want to ask any high lvl player to help you find BPs, preferably best antares ones, but since you will probably not be able to afford that (a full best antares ship costs at least 12000 cryonite), you might want to look for terasa ones first. While you are getting BPs, you will also gain a lot of experience. Leveling up is easy in Antares and you will be lvl 18 in no ime. REMEMBER, even though you may be able to buy a lvl 18 ship, DO NOT buy one until you have the best BPs and at least 6000 cryonite. When you decide to buy one, DO NOT sell your vega ship. This is one of the most important advice you will get as a pilot, NEVER, I mean never, sell any ship!!!

Ok now that you got your antares ship, please do not rush too much to complete the story missions. Focus on doing whites so you have enough cryonite for the next system. Remember, the next system ship costs 3000 cryonite, and with all the armor upgrades it will be at least 6000 cryonite only for the ship. The best BPs cost about 1500-1700, so you really need cryonite for that system. Doing white missions will help you a lot, but you can also return to Vega and shoot mantis harvesters, they give nice cryonite. So when you see that you have enough cry for Gemini system, you can go there if you completed antares story missions already.

Gemini has lots of new challenges, such as the Death Squads, but by now you must have the experience to advance through it. Only remember to not rush and stay back to complete white missions, or after you acquire a gemini ship you can return to Vega shoot mantis harvesters for cryonite. After Gemini, comes Mizar, which does not bring anything new. As long as you follow my cryonite making guide, you will master Mizar in no time. Sol is not much different, only you will have some trouble in the Moon. By now you should have joined a clan already, and they will help you with the missions. Full equipped lvl 60 sol ship costs about 100k cryonite. You might want to grind in Prosperous or squad up in Molikar with someone else.

Draconis will be a lot of challenge for you. Since Mars and the moon are easy in your lvl 60 ship, you might want to go and finish their white missions before you install any draconis item in your ship (you wont be able to do Sol missions with that). Even by doing so, you will still need a lot of cryonite for your draconis ship. Ask your clan for BP and experience hunting. My advice is to grind in Molikar before you reach lvl 70 so that after you are done all you will have to do is make some exp and unlock the ships. You will need at least 420k for a full deluvian lvl 70 ship. I know it will take a lot of time, you will need a lot of patience for this. Even after you get the ship, you will have a lot of trouble with draconis story missions. Do not try alone, it would be best to ask around for help, only remember, do not be very annoying when asking.

Now, here are a few things to always remember:
-Never try to rush through the game. By rushing I mean try to complete systems as fast as possible. Please, take it slowly, the next system will be there for you, it wont disappear. Do as much white missions as possible before going to the next system

-Never sell any ship!!! Eventually you will need to replace your sold ships for conquest and guess what? It will take you much more cry. If you are so desperate, sell some of the BPs, but never, ever, sell the ship itself. You will only get half of the cry u paid for the ship, but any cry paid for the armors will not be refunded. So do not sell ships.

-The most important, have fun!!! Remember, its just a game, do not take it very seriously.

Green - Cryonite
Blue - Blueprint
Yellow - Story Mission
White - Normal/white mission
Red - IMPORTANT

Ok the white missions. how do you get them? i finished all the missions in vega. Do I do them over again? I still have quite a few white missions left
 
A

Adrana

The white missions is shown at the mission panel with White text if they are not done.
You need to do off those first and then will appear new white ones, if there is more.
You are only given pay and xp for the first time you do them.

Now, there are some changes on Prelude webpage. All ships armor is reduced. Can anyone explain that? For example if you click on Armor and Damage simulator, you can see that armor for all ships is not what it used to be and its lower.
I m giving some big ships examples

Ship ///// Previous armor hitpoints ///// Current armor hitpoints
Meta tank ///// 12800 ///// 7693
Meta SDX engineer ///// 9600 ///// 5770
Parsec Terrorizer ///// 12160 ///// 6924
Parsec Storm ///// 12800 ///// 7693
Parsec Dominator ///// 19200 ///// 11540
Ancient Myst ///// 14400 ///// 8640
Ancient Punisher ///// 19200 ///// 11540

Hitpoints measures of all ships are changed, therefore I conclude that this could be different method of armor calculation in place, rather then some changes in armor in game by Splitscreen.
